At this point the sync reconciler began rejecting queued survey records created while devices were offline in the Hollowmere pilot region. Plugin authors should note: the reconciler's conflict hook fired with a null baseline, which is the condition your merge handlers must now tolerate. We confirmed the regression was introduced by the offline cache rewrite, not by any third-party plugin. Handlers written against the old contract silently dropped records. The artifact in which the regression first appeared is recorded below.

session token of tajef-bageg = htk21_5d90d574934f3ccae6437

Ticket: Staging env misconfigured for Siftgate bloom filter

The bloom layer in front of the Pellet KV store is rejecting all lookups in staging because the env file was copied from the dev template without credentials. False-positive tuning values are fine; only the auth line is missing. To unblock the weekly demo, the Pellet admission secret must be set on the following line.

env line for yaguf-fajop: LEDGER_TOKEN13=fb08984397349

Ticket #— Locked vault blocking Lattice UI component releases

The Fernwick release vault locked itself after three failed signing attempts, so we can't publish Lattice UI v4.2 to the shared component registry. Plugin authors pinned to the v4.x range won't see the deprecation shims until this ships, so please hold any major-version bumps in your manifests. Our release engineer will reopen the vault today. For reference, the vault accepts the recovery passphrase below.

unlock words, tawif-tahop: oliys-ulawyn-tamdor-lamys-casox-jormir-fraius-kasath-ulador-ulamir-holir-sorys-holeth